13.3 Supply
Table 63: Supply
Supply voltage V
S
18VDC … 30VDC, reverse polarity protected
Current consumption (with‐
out load)
Without heating: <250mA at 24VDC
With heating: <1,000mA at 24VDC
Residual ripple <5V
SS
within the permissible supply voltage U
V
13.4 Inputs
Table 64: Inputs
Inputs Multifunctional input MF1, switching function adjustable
Switching type: Sink for PNP output (open input corresponds to the
LOW input signal)
HIGH >12V
LOW <3V
Circuit protection None, no reverse-polarity protection.
13.5 Outputs
Table 65: Outputs
Outputs Multifunctional outputs MF1 and MF2, type B (push/pull), adjusta‐
ble switching function
HIGH > U
V
– 3V
LOW <2V
Circuit protection
Short-circuit protected
Overload-proof
Maximum output current Max. 100mA
Output load
Capacitive: 100nF
Inductive: 20mH
13.6 Interfaces
Table 66: Interfaces
Process data interface CANopen
Ethernet Configuration/Service interface (SOPAS ET)
13.7 Ambient data
Table 67: Ambient data
Protection class
Suitable for operation in PELV (Protective Extra Low Voltage) sys‐
tems with safe separation.
Electromagnetic compati‐
bility
EN61000-6-2, EN61000-6-4, Class A
Ambient operating temper‐
ature range
–20...+55°C
2)
–40...+55°C (with integrated heating)
3)
-20...+75°C (with cooler housing TPCC)
